DoT damage is now tracked for loot permissions.
XP rewards in combat now correctly reflect amount of damage that was done by dots.
The Devs (TH especially) complains that we need to be NERF'd but then give us the above to changes...I appreciate having them back, but it does create the potential for abuse and grief more then ever...And this inturn will lead to more NERF cried against our profession guarenteed...
Special abilities that inflict combat DoT's (Fire and Bleeds), have had there initial strike damage increased and the combat DoT damage reduced.
It should be noted (as it was in another post) that this has to do with all DoT weapons...not just ours...This will be very good for us PvE (although the loss of stacking hurts more for PvE)...PvP should be interesting...Should be interesting to test exactly how much more damage a FWG5 does (for example) firing a /healthshot2 from a distance...Wonder if this will help us or hurt us in ranged fights? Sounds to me like a Pistoleer can now do more damage to us from a distance then they could before...and we still need to get into 16m range to take advantage of our increased damage...

Bleed/Fire resistant clothing will now have an effect.
Reminder..."resistant" clothing slows the speed of our DoT burn rate...not the actual damage done...so this should also be an interesting change for us...Not only can't we stack DoTs, the burn damage was reduced, but the rate of the burn is also reduced for anyone with this protection. Triple hit!!!
DoT resist changes will make AT-STs more resistant to DoT damage. Dot resistances have been added giving the AT-ST extra protection against flamethrowers and other fire DoT based attacks.
With the Imperial Crackdown in place we'll see more fights with ATSTs...should be interesting to see how this effects the profession that is suppose to be specifically designed to deal with this menance...lol...
